Ricoh SC543 Fusing Overheat Error

What it means

The fusing unit read a temperature above its safe range, so the machine stopped itself. This is a protective stop rather than damage in itself. Because it involves a heating element, a code that repeats after a reset is one to hand to a technician rather than keep clearing.

Is the SC543 error serious?

This one usually points at a hardware fault rather than something a setting will clear, so treat an unchanged result after a power cycle as a reason to contact the manufacturer rather than to keep trying.
